Advanced Installer Architect 21.1
Released: Oct 4, 2023
21.1 での更新項目
機能
- Test your installation packages directly within Microsoft Windows Sandbox.
- Added a new command to set the 'Condition' field of a Component.
- Added Microsoft PowerShell automation support for 'Call function from DLL' custom actions.
- Added command line support for basic SQL operations.
- Optimized 'SqlDatabases' view loading time.
- Added the option to skip SQL script installation if SQL connection fails.
- Added command line support for setting Microsoft Azure 'KeyVault' signing parameters.
- Added the ability to validate the 'UpgradeCode' property format when using the 'SetProperty' command.
- Added support for copying and pasting in MSIX Manifest Editor.
- UI improvement: Now opens the current location when selecting a new package in the Updates configuration project.
- Added a new parameter for '/SetDigitalCertificateFile' and '/SetAzureKeyVaultParameters' commands to activate digital signing.
- Improved import of .pri file created by Microsoft Visual Studio for WinUI apps.
- You can now display project output detection errors in the output window.
- Registration improvement: Now prioritizes the last registration method used.
不具合の修正
- DLL vulnerability fix: Prevent unauthorized access while loading comctl32.dll.
- Translations didn't work on v21.0.1 when EUI was enabled.
- An incorrect message is shown for a reboot initiated by prerequisites.
- Crash when opening the Themes page after conversion.
- Fixed UI bugs on the framework prerequisites category.
- The UAC icon is missing when using "InstallTypeDlg".
- Registry keys related to the Context Menu in Windows 11 are not correctly removed for the Sparse Package signed with a certificate that has spaces in the name.
- The "Enable Log" option does not work for chained prerequisites.
- The extracted prerequisite's name is cropped at the beginning.
- Increased the size of the "Launch when ready" control for advinst.msi.
- The prerequisite command line field is replaced with the arguments of a previously selected prerequisite.
- Project Summary issues incorrectly listed package prerequisites.
- The synchronized folder is not updated correctly in the latest versions.
- Paste operation does not work for Transactions and folders in SQL Databases view.
- The order of the scripts is the same as before the drag & drop operation.
- An error message is thrown when a pre-install prerequisite is set to skip.
- The "PrerequisitesDlg" dialog is displayed after reboot even if all prerequisites are installed.
- Issues with the SQL Server Express prerequisites in v20.9.1.
- SQL Script can be placed outside the connection.
- MSIX Package Version was no longer in sync with the Product Details view from MSI.
- Advanced Installer was hanging after the "Run in VM" operation.
- Advanced Installer now provides correct values in the Summary Information for the "Last Printed" and Last "Saved Time/Date" fields, eliminating discrepancies during Orca validation.
- Headers for unsigned files are modified during signing process.